The Political Progress of Britain, Part 1: Or An Impartial History of Abuses in the Government of the British Empire is a book written by James Thomson Callender in 1795. The book provides a detailed account of the political history of Britain, specifically focusing on the abuses and corruption that have occurred within the government of the British Empire. Callender's work is considered to be a significant contribution to the political literature of the time, as it sheds light on the various issues that plagued the British government in the late 18th century. The book covers a range of topics, including the influence of the aristocracy, the corruption of the judiciary, and the exploitation of the working classes.
